Google Sites uses themes. Each theme has a set of colours and fonts. When you choose a theme, those colours and fonts apply to all pages, and you cannot change them. Each page consists of several sections, and you can change the style or background image for each section. To do this, click on the painter's palette icon on the left, next to the text.
You can only add a video that is already on YouTube. When you try to add a video, Google Sites will open its own YouTube search screen. If you have the link to a video, you can also paste it there.
When you make a video with your phone, you first need to upload it to a YouTube channel. Make sure to set the privacy settings for the video to 'public' or 'unlisted'. Otherwise, you will not be able to view the video on the website.
The Google Sites editor shows how the website will appear on a computer screen. You can check how your website will look on a phone or tablet by clicking the icon with a 'tablet and mobile phone' at the top of the screen. Refer to the red arrow in the image next to this text.
Before others can view the site you must publish it. You do that with the blue button at the top of the screen. Make sure your website meets all requirements. You can find out what the requirements are in the blog rubric.
